Reports to:

Manager, Regulatory Compliance



Purpose of the Role



Provide medical laboratory leadership, discipline-specific technical expertise and quality management consultation to Operations. Ensure processes and procedures remain current and compliant with scientific advancements, technical developments and regulatory requirements of their discipline-specific field of Medical Laboratory Science.



Your responsibilities will include:



Provide troubleshooting, technical and quality assurance/quality systems support for methodologies, equipment and supplies currently in use. Ensure department policies, processes, procedures and forms remain current with applicable regulations, legislation, and best practice. Lead in-function projects and act as subject-matter experts for cross-function projects, as appropriate. Support the internal/external assessment process and collaborate with stakeholders to develop and implement corrective actions Liaise with external stakeholders including the Diagnostic Accreditation Program (DAP) and Accreditation Canada Diagnostics (ACD) Provides support to Medical/Scientific, Supply Chain Management, Business Development, IT and other support departments as required.

What you bring to the role:



College Diploma in Medical Laboratory Technology or equivalent education and experience. In Ontario, current registration with College of Medical Laboratory Technologists of Ontario (CMLTO). In British Columbia, current registration with Canadian Society for Medical Laboratory Science (CSMLS). Minimum of 3 years previous discipline-specific laboratory experience Strong technical and quality systems knowledge and understanding to provide discipline specific, expert technical and scientific support to all customers, internal and external. Proven ability to facilitate compliance with the Quality Management System within a regulated environment A clear understanding of regulatory compliance processes and the business impact of failing to meet external regulatory requirements. Facilitation skills necessary to lead discipline specific teams, and the confidence to conduct audits, issue non-conformance reports requiring correction actions, and follow-up on continues non-compliance. The ability to use sound risk management analysis to assess the regulatory and business impact of prioritizing goals. Excellent verbal communication skills to effectively communicate decisions and seek input. Excellent technical writing skills to support the creation, review, and maintenance of documentation. Strong organization, change and project management skills to ensure that deliverables are achieved on schedule and in a controlled manner. Occasional travel required
